watchOS 6.2.5 brings ECG app in Saudi Arabia, new Pride watch faces
New watch faces are available to match this year’s Pride Edition Sport Bands for Apple Watch.

Apple has released watchOS 6.2.5 to the public. This is the eighth update to the watchOS 6 operating system, bringing new Pride-themed watch faces and improvements.
According to the watchOS 6.2.5 release notes, the update adds ECG app support and irregular heart rhythm notifications in Saudi Arabia. The ECG app is available on Apple Watch Series 4 or later. Apple brought the same set of features in three additional countries, including Chile, New Zealand, and Turkey, with watchOS 6.2 earlier this year. Now, the list just added Saudi Arabia as well.
Although not mentioned by Apple’s release notes, the Pride-themed watch faces are included to match this year’s Pride Edition Sport Bands for Apple Watch. There’s also watchOS 5.3.7 update available for users who have an Apple Watch paired with an iPhone running iOS 12.
You can download watchOS 6.2.5 for Apple Watch from the dedicated Watch app on the iPhone. Head over to General > Software Update. Make sure your wearable is charged at least 50 percent, placed on a charger, and is in range of the iPhone.
